Description | The Oroboros O2k-FluoRespirometer (O2k-Series H) - the experimental system complete for high-resolution respirometry (HRR), including fluorometry and the TIP2k, allowing simultaneous monitoring of oxygen consumption together with either ROS production (AmR), mt-membrane potential (TMRM, Safranin and Rhodamine 123), Ca2+ (CaG) or ATP production (MgG).
The O2k-FluoRespirometer supports all add-on O2k-Modules: O2k-TPP+ ISE-Module, O2k-pH ISE-Module, O2k-NO Amp-Module, enabling measurement of mt-membrane potential with ion sensitive electrode (ISE for TPP+ or TPMP+ ) or pH.

Features: integrated FluoRespirometry
- The Fluorescence-control unit is integrated into the O2k-Main Unit. The new O2k-Window Frame is optimized for fixation of the Fluorescence-Sensors. The previous Window Tool, Front Fixation and Sensor-Guide are not required.
- Smart Fluo-Sensors are pre-calibrated with sensor-specific memory and direct input into DatLab 7. O2k-Series A to G do not support the Smart Fluo-Sensors.
Features of O2k-Series H:
- Fluo-Control Unit integrated into O2k-Main Unit.
- Smart Fluo-Sensors with pre-calibrated light intensities for direct input into DatLab 7
- DL-Protocols as real-time guides for titrations in DatLab 7, context-sensitive help. Further details » MitoPedia: DatLab.

Electronic innovations
- High-resolution A-D converter: The new 24 bit analogue-digital converters provide a higher precision in measurement of O2, Amp-signals (amperometric fluorometry and nitric oxide measurements), and pX-signals (potentiometric measurements).
- Core Relative Humidity and Core Relative Temperature: In addition to the built-in ambient temperature sensor, two new measurement channels are implemented to continuously monitor conditions within the electronic Main-Unit. Such data are especially important for quality control of experiments performed at high humidity and varying external temperature.
- A 16 GB, industry-rated flash drive is integrated for storage of calibration files and other instrument-specific data. (This function will be available upon release of a later version of DatLab).
- USB 2.0 Hi-Speed hub (4 external ports) for additional USB devices.
- Three internal USB ports allow further upgrades and upwards compatibility with new developments.
- Increased energy efficiency based on the new O2k-electronics design: power consumption is 24 W at 37 °C (80% reduction compared to Series D). Running costs are substantially lower as a result of our general concept for sustainable technology. The maximal power input is 120 W.
- O2k net weight is reduced to 13.5 kg in comparison to 21 kg in Series D.
